Prep Time: 30 mins
Cook Time: 1 hrs
Total Time: 1 hrs 30 mins
Cuisine: Italian
Serves: 6 servings
Ingredients
- 9 lasagna noodles
- 2 cups ricotta cheese
- 2 cups spinach, cooked and chopped
- 2 cups marinara sauce
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up mozzarella cheese, shredded
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Prepare a 9x13 inch baking dish by lightly greasing it with olive oil or cooking spray.
- Begin by preparing the Bolognese sauce. In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add chopped onions and minced garlic, sautéing until the onions become translucent and fragrant, about 3-4 minutes.
- Add ground beef to the skillet, breaking it up with a wooden spoon. Cook until the meat is completely browned and no pink remains, approximately 7-8 minutes. Drain excess fat if necessary.
- Stir in marinara sauce to the meat mixture.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Simmer the sauce on low heat for 10-15 minutes to allow flavors to meld together.
- In a separate bowl, mix ricotta cheese with cooked and chopped spinach. Season with a pinch of salt and pepper. Mix thoroughly to combine.
- Cook lasagna noodles according to package instructions in salted boiling water until al dente. Drain and rinse with cold water to prevent sticking.
- Begin layering the lasagna. Spread a thin layer of Bolognese sauce on the bottom of the baking dish to prevent sticking.
- Place a layer of lasagna noodles, followed by a spread of ricotta-spinach mixture, Bolognese sauce, mozzarella, and a sprinkle of Parmesan cheese.
- Repeat layering process two more times, ensuring the top layer is covered with sauce and cheese.
- Cover the baking dish with aluminum foil, making sure it doesn't touch the cheese. Bake in the preheated oven for 25 minutes.
- Remove foil and continue baking for an additional 15-20 minutes until the cheese is golden and bubbly.
- Remove from oven and let the lasagna rest for 10-15 minutes before serving. This allows the layers to set and makes cutting easier.
- Slice into portions, garnish with fresh basil if desired, and serve hot.
Tips
- Use fresh ingredients: The quality of your ingredients can make or break this dish. Opt for fresh spinach and high-quality ground beef for the best flavor.
- Don't overcook the noodles: Cook lasagna noodles just until al dente to prevent them from becoming mushy during baking.
- Let it rest: Allowing the lasagna to rest for 10-15 minutes after baking helps the layers set and makes cutting and serving much easier.
- Layer with care: Ensure even distribution of sauce, cheese, and filling in each layer for a perfectly balanced bite.
- Cover while baking: Using aluminum foil prevents the top from burning while allowing the lasagna to cook evenly.
- Make ahead option: This lasagna can be prepared in advance and refrigerated before baking, making it perfect for meal prep or entertaining.
- Customize to taste: Feel free to add extra herbs like basil or oregano to enhance the flavor profile.
